The Challenge
Financial institutions face an ever-evolving fraud landscape — account takeovers, synthetic identity fraud, card-not-present attacks, and insider threats. Rule-based detection systems generate excessive false positives (frustrating genuine customers) while missing novel fraud vectors. The cost is measured not just in financial losses, but in customer trust and regulatory scrutiny.
